The FORD PASS on my '23R has been unresponsive after having the Oil Leak CSB performed. After spending some time on the phone with Ford Pass, they said I needed to let the dealer diagnose what is going on with it. Today, they had to work with Ford Engineering and concluded that the TCU needs replacing. Part is ordered and I'll post back here if that fixed the problem.

You can remote start from the key fob, but not your phone. I’m good with that anyway. Just so you know, you can’t physically stop them from gathering your data from the Sync screen in the vehicle. You can “turn off” the communication to YOUR Ford Pass app, but what they don't tell you is that THEY can still see your data, but YOU just can’t see it in the app. The only way to fully turn off their access is to disable the vehicle’s communication device itself.
